WordPress powers over 40% of all websites on the internet, making it the go-to choice for many. Businesses that use it often see a significant boost in online visibility and customer engagement. With its user-friendly interface, flexible features, and strong SEO capabilities, WordPress makes website creation accessible for everyone. This guide walks you step-by-step through building your site on WordPress, ensuring you grasp all necessary skills.

Choosing the Right Hosting and Domain Name
Selecting a Reliable Web Host
Choosing a good web host is crucial. Look for key factors including:
- Uptime: Aim for 99.9% or better.
- Speed: Faster loading times improve user experience and SEO.
- Customer Support: 24/7 support can help resolve issues quickly.
Here are some reputable hosting providers:
Web Host | Uptime | Speed | Price per Month | Customer Support |
---|---|---|---|---|
SiteGround | 99.9% | High | $6.99 | 24/7 Live Chat |
Bluehost | 99.98% | High | $2.95 | 24/7 Phone |
HostGator | 99.9% | Moderate | $2.75 | 24/7 Live Chat |
Registering a Catchy Domain Name
A memorable domain name boosts your brand’s online presence. Here are some tips for choosing a domain:
- Keep it short and simple.
- Use keywords related to your business.
- Avoid numbers and hyphens.
For registration, consider these domain registrars:
Installing WordPress
Downloading WordPress
To start, download the latest version from the official website. Here are the steps to install it:
- Use Hosting Control Panel: Log into your hosting account and find the WordPress installer within cPanel.
- One-Click Installer: Many hosts offer one-click installation options. Just click, fill in some details, and you’re good to go.
Configuring WordPress Settings
Once installed, it’s time to configure your WordPress settings.
- Site Title: Set your site name.
- Tagline: Add a brief description.
- Admin Username/Password: Use strong passwords to keep your site secure.
- Basic SEO Settings: Add your site title and meta description for better visibility.
Designing Your Website
Choosing a WordPress Theme
Choosing the right theme lays the groundwork for your site. Look for themes that match your brand. Popular options include:
- Astra
- OceanWP
- GeneratePress
When evaluating themes, check for responsiveness and simplicity.

Customizing Your Theme
Use the WordPress customizer for personalization. Here’s how:
- Go to your dashboard, select Appearance, then Customize.
- Adjust colors, fonts, and layouts to fit your brand.
Page builders like Elementor and Beaver Builder can help create unique layouts without code.
Adding Essential Plugins
Plugins enhance your site’s functionality. Here are some must-have plugins:
- Yoast SEO: Helps optimize your content for search engines.
- Wordfence Security: Protects your site from threats.
- WP Super Cache: Improves site speed.
Use plugins wisely to avoid site slowdowns.
Creating and Managing Content
Writing Engaging Blog Posts
Writing quality content keeps readers engaged. Here are some simple strategies:
- Use catchy headlines to grab attention.
- Write clear, concise introductions.
- Break up text with bullet points and images.
For improving writing skills, consider resources like Grammarly or writing courses.
Optimizing Images for Web
Optimizing images speeds up your site and boosts SEO. Here’s what to do:
- Use tools like TinyPNG or ImageOptim to compress images.
- Always use the right file format (JPEG for photos, PNG for graphics).
Managing WordPress Pages
Understand the difference between posts and pages:
- Posts: Great for blog entries and updates.
- Pages: Ideal for static content like the About Us or Contact Us sections.
Create organized content through categories and tags to enhance user navigation.
Promoting Your Website
Basic SEO Optimization
On-page SEO is vital for increasing visibility. Consider these practices:
- Perform keyword research using tools like SEMrush or Ahrefs.
- Write meta descriptions and title tags that entice clicks.
Don’t forget to verify your site on Google Search Console.
Utilizing Social Media Marketing
Promote your content through social media. Here’s how:
- Share blog posts on platforms like Facebook, Twitter, and Instagram.
- Engage with followers and respond to comments.
Visit social media sites to create business profiles.

Building Backlinks
Backlinks enhance your site’s authority. Good strategies include:
- Guest blogging on reputable sites.
- Collaborating with influencers to feature your content.
Research ethical link-building techniques to avoid penalties.
Conclusion
Building a website on WordPress involves several key steps, from choosing hosting and a domain to designing your site and promoting it. The benefits of using WordPress are extensive, including ease of use, flexibility, and strong SEO capabilities. Start your website journey today and unleash your online potential! Don’t wait—build your dream website now!